  1. 1 Whether the appellant failed to display a list of maximum prices as required by law
  2. 2 Whether the appellant sold controlled goods above the maximum price fixed by law
  3. 3 Whether the conviction and sentence on both counts were proper

Ratio Decidendi

The conviction and sentence on count one (failure to display maximum prices) were quashed due to lack of evidence proving the specific offence charged. The conviction on count two (overcharging) was upheld as the evidence established the appellant sold a controlled good above the maximum price and did not return the change. The sentence of imprisonment on count two was substituted with a fine, as the offence was compoundable and imprisonment was not warranted by the circumstances.

Court Disposition

Appeal allowed in part, dismissed in part.

Orders

  • Conviction and sentence on count one quashed; fine to be refunded to appellant.
  • Conviction on count two upheld; sentence of 9 months imprisonment set aside and substituted with a fine of shs.1,500/= or distress in default.
